FUEL FEED UNIT AND TWO-STROKE ENGINE HAVING A FUEL FEED UNIT
A fuel feed unit has a base body with an intake channel section, into which a fuel opening opens. A partition wall section divides the intake channel section into a mixture channel and an air channel. The wall section has a recess in which the throttle flap at least partially lies in an end position. The wall section has, upstream of the recess, a continuous surface facing the mixture channel and which has lateral sections adjacent to the channel wall and a middle section running between the lateral sections. The lateral sections have, upstream of the throttle flap, a separation edge for the flow. In the end position, the side of the throttle flap facing the mixture channel defines a reference plane which divides the unit into a first region and a second region. The lateral sections extend, at least directly upstream of the recess, into the second region.
Mechanism for opening/closing intake member
Provided is an opening/closing mechanism for an intake member which enables backlash suppression a working member and positioning of a choke lever. The opening/closing mechanism includes the intake member that accommodates a filter part and has an opening leading to a carburetor at an end wall portion facing the filter part; an opening/closing member that is disposed between the filter part and the end wall portion, and opens and closes the opening; and a working member that is disposed on a side opposite to the opening/closing member with the end wall portion interposed therebetween. The working member includes an arm portion that extends along the end wall portion and is coupled with the opening/closing member at one end by sandwiching the end wall portion therebetween, and a holding portion that is provided at the other end of the arm portion, the intake member has a guide hole into which the arm portion is inserted to guide movement of the arm portion, the guide hole has a first fixing portion that fixes the arm portion on one side in a movement direction of the arm portion, and a second fixing portion that fixes the arm portion on the other side in the movement direction of the arm portion, and widths of the first fixing portion and the second fixing portion of the guide hole are respectively equal to or less than a width of the arm portion.

Opening/closing mechanism of intake member
An opening/closing mechanism of an intake member includes: an intake member that accommodates a filter part and has an opening leading to a carburetor in an end wall opposing the filter part; an opening/closing member disposed between the filter part and the end wall, and opens/closes the opening; and a working member disposed on an opposite side to the opening/closing member so as to interpose the end wall, and allows the opening/closing member to be operated. The working member includes: an arm part which extends along the end wall and is linked with the opening/closing member to interpose the end wall at one end part, and a holding part provided to another end part of the arm part. The intake member has a guide hole into which the arm part is inserted and guides movement of the arm part.

MANUALLY OPERATED CHOKE LEVER ASSEMBLIES INCORPORATING A CABLE SYSTEM
An improvement to snowmobile choke lever lift pull on/off assemblies that use a manual style choke system incorporating a single or plurality cable system. The sockets that engage the cables of the cable system may be provide lateral or upper access ports. The choke lever at the distal end of the assembly may be movable from a first position to a second position by engaging the cable system, wherein an actuating element returns the choke lever to the first position. The present invention affords replacement of existing choke lever assemblies, wherein the choke lever and other components of the present invention may be made from metallic materials that increase the assembly's durability and half-life.

Gas idling transition passage structure for oil and gas dual-purpose carburetor
The utility model provides a gas idling transition passage structure for oil and gas dual-purpose carburetor, comprising a carburetor body 1 and a mixing chamber 4; a choke valve 5 and a throttle valve 9 are disposed in the mixing chamber 4 in the order of the air flow direction; a gas intake pipe 2 for supplying gas to the mixing chamber 4 is disposed on the carburetor body 1; a first air inlet pipe 7 and a second air inlet pipe 8 are disposed in the carburetor body 1 in parallel; an opening of an outlet end of the second air inlet pipe 8 is located in the mixing chamber 4 and the position of the outlet end of the second air inlet pipe 8 is at the intersection of an outer circle and the mixing chamber 4 when the throttle valve 9 is closed.
